Gate Drivers Microchip Technology TC4420IJA Overview
The Gate Drivers Microchip Technology TC4420IJA is a robust low-side gate driver, housed in an 8CERDIP package, specifically designed to enhance the efficiency and performance of your power management systems. This gate driver is capable of delivering high peak output currents up to 6A, operating across a wide voltage range from 4.5V to 18V. Its high-speed performance and rugged design make it an ideal choice for driving MOSFETs and IGBTs in a variety of demanding applications. The TC4420IJA ensures reliable operation with its built-in protection features, including undervoltage lockout and matched propagation delays, making it a cornerstone in developing high-efficiency, reliable electronic solutions.
TC4420IJA Features
- High peak output current of 6A suitable for driving large capacitive loads with high slew rates.
- Wide operating voltage range of 4.5V to 18V, accommodating various application needs.
- Matched rise and fall times ensure efficient switching with reduced timing errors.
- High capacitive load driving capability, ideal for modern power electronics that require robust drive characteristics.
- Enhanced robustness with built-in undervoltage lockout and thermal shutdown features for reliable operation under adverse conditions.
- Latch-up resistant technology up to 1.5A, providing protection against overcurrent scenarios.
TC4420IJA Applications
- Motor Control: Utilized in DC brushless and stepper motor drive circuits to enhance speed and direction control accuracy.
- Solar Inverters: Key component in photovoltaic systems for converting DC output of a solar panel into AC, enhancing efficiency and response time of the inverter circuit.
- Power Supplies: Drives switches in both isolated and non-isolated power supply designs, improving efficiency and power regulation.
- LED Lighting: Employs in LED drivers to provide stable and efficient control of the power stage, ensuring consistent illumination and longevity of lighting systems.
- Automotive Applications: Used in automotive electronics for driving sensors and actuators, improving performance and reliability of vehicle systems.
